NettetGood sources of vitamin C. Vitamin C is found in a wide variety of fruit and vegetables. Good sources include: citrus fruit, such as oranges and orange juice; peppers; strawberries; blackcurrants; broccoli; brussels sprouts; potatoes; How much vitamin C do I need? Adults aged 19 to 64 need 40mg of vitamin C a day. One-half grapefruit measuring approximately 3 3/4" in diameter (123g) provides 52 calories, 0.9g of protein, 13.2g of carbohydrates, and 0.2g of fat. Grapefruits are an excellent source of vitamin C and vitamin A. The following nutrition information is provided by the USDA. 1. Calories: 52.

Nettet9. des. 2024 · You'll get nearly 70 milligrams of vitamin C from a medium orange. If you find bigger oranges that are 3 inches in diameter and weigh approximately 185 grams or 6.5 ounces, you'll get almost 100...
